Exercise can also be addictive American psychology and sports medicine experts believe that when exercise is no longer a pleasure, and the participant believes that he or she must exercise and cannot stop, regardless of the consequences, even when he or she is in poor physical or mental condition, then he or she is likely to be addicted to exercise. In other words, exercise has become a compulsive behavior for these people. For these people with compulsive exercise behavior, exercise becomes the most unshakable "item" in their daily life, more important than work, school, friends or family. Even if you are sick or injured, you still "insist" on exercising. If you don't exercise for a day, you will feel "uncomfortable all over", which often leads to excessive exercise. Are you addicted to exercise? Compare: 1 The single form of exercise leads to a fixed schedule for daily physical activity; 2 In order to ensure exercise, exercisers gradually give priority to exercise over other matters; 3 The exercisers' tolerance for high-intensity exercise gradually increases, which further leads to a vicious cycle of repeated exercise; 4 Once regular exercise stops, signs of a disturbed mood state appear, but once exercise is resumed, the disturbance is alleviated or disappears, further consolidating the "vicious cycle"; 5 People who exercise feel they have to exercise. Exercise addiction makes people stupid
"Life lies in exercise", it can shape our strong body and enhance our ability to resist disease. However, exercise has its limits for the human body. Once it exceeds this limit, it may not only be useless but harmful to the human body. Recently, American neuroscientists discovered in a study that the brain responses of mice addicted to exercise were slower than those of mice with normal exercise. Therefore, Dr. Chen Linhui from the Department of Neurology at Zhejiang Hospital pointed out that "although exercise is good for the brain, it should be done in moderation." When exercising excessively, the human body consumes a lot of energy, and functional inhibition occurs to prevent further energy consumption. At this time, people will feel extremely tired, weak all over, and their brain reactions will slow down. If you exercise excessively for a long time, the sensitivity of the body's "protective inhibition" function will decrease, causing damage to the brain function. The main symptoms include: inattention, insomnia, forgetfulness, etc. If this continues for a long time, it will cause great harm to human health. Exercise in moderation is good for health

Huang Xiong'ang said that exercise can give us a strong body, but we must never go to extremes. The best exercise is to choose a sport that suits you and share the joy of exercise with others. Exercise addiction can be overcome, but it takes time. First, choose a variety of forms of exercise and don’t rely too much on one form; Second, the sports you choose should be technical and difficult, requiring a certain amount of effort to complete; Third, the project you choose should be competitive and require cooperation with others to complete; fourth, you should work hard to cultivate interest in other activities so that you feel that in addition to sports, there are other more important and meaningful things to do. |
